Abstract:The results of studying the mass spectrum of μ+μ?γγ systems produced in π?p collisions at 25 and 33 GeV/c presented. The wide-aperture magnetic spectrometer with a hodoscope γ-detector was used to identify muon pairs and photons. There is a clear peak in the mass spectrum which corresponds to the decay ωπ0μ+μ? previously not observed. The branching ratio for the decay is estimated to be 9 × 10?5 with a systematic error of 50%.
